Having just finished filming for The Hunger Games: Mockingjay – Part 2, Jennifer is already filming a new drama entitled Joy, which again teams Ms. Lawrence with her American Hustle co-star Bradley Cooper. Also on the table for Ms. Lawrence is X-Men: Apocalypse and the Steven Spielberg-directed biopic, It’s What I Do: A Photographer’s Life of Love and War, in which Jennifer will play the famed photographer Lynsey Addario.
